Senator Williams's keynote address at the 2024 Environmental Summit emphasized the need for bipartisan cooperation on climate legislation. In her speech, Williams directly appealed to both political parties to prioritize long-term environmental protection over short-term economic concerns: _____

Which excerpt from the speech best demonstrates this appeal?

A

'The science is clear: climate change poses unprecedented risks to our economy and our children's future, requiring bold action from Congress.'

B

'Both Republicans and Democrats have constituents who breathe the same air and drink the same water—environmental protection should unite us across party lines.'

C

'I call upon my colleagues on both sides of the aisle to set aside partisan politics and work together to pass comprehensive climate legislation that prioritizes our planet's health over corporate profits, ensuring a sustainable future for generations to come.'

D

'Historical analysis shows that environmental legislation has typically required bipartisan support to achieve meaningful implementation.'

Step 3: Prethink the Answer

  • The correct excerpt must show two key elements working together:
    • A direct appeal to both political parties (not just general statements about climate)
    • A clear call to prioritize long-term environmental protection over short-term economic concerns
  • We need to see Williams specifically addressing both Republicans and Democrats
  • We need to see her explicitly asking them to put environmental concerns above immediate economic interests
Answer Choices Explained
A

'The science is clear: climate change poses unprecedented risks to our economy and our children's future, requiring bold action from Congress.'

✗ Incorrect

  • Focuses on the science and risks but doesn't address both parties directly
  • No mention of prioritizing environmental concerns over economic ones
B

'Both Republicans and Democrats have constituents who breathe the same air and drink the same water—environmental protection should unite us across party lines.'

✗ Incorrect

  • Does address both parties but missing the key element about prioritizing environmental protection over short-term economic concerns
  • This choice captures the bipartisan element but misses the economic vs. environmental priority aspect
C

'I call upon my colleagues on both sides of the aisle to set aside partisan politics and work together to pass comprehensive climate legislation that prioritizes our planet's health over corporate profits, ensuring a sustainable future for generations to come.'

✓ Correct

  • Directly addresses 'colleagues on both sides of the aisle' (bipartisan appeal)
  • Explicitly calls to 'set aside partisan politics and work together' (bipartisan cooperation)
  • Clearly prioritizes 'planet's health over corporate profits' (environmental protection over economic concerns)
  • Uses action language 'I call upon' matching the passage's 'directly appealed'
D

'Historical analysis shows that environmental legislation has typically required bipartisan support to achieve meaningful implementation.'

✗ Incorrect

  • Describes historical patterns rather than making a direct appeal
  • No call to action or direct address to both parties
